 | | jessicafischerqueen: <Canyonero> Fantastic! Very interesting review of the only Charousek biography that's been translated into English, Victor Charuchin's "Chess Comet Charousek." It's a largely accurate review that's marred- significantly, in my view- by the reviewer's negative "know it all" attitude. Now, I don't have a problem with such an attitude per se, so long as you have your facts straight. However, if you are going to adopt it, you had better be *extra* careful to get your facts straight. And this reviewer is not extra careful, or even particularly careful. The reviewer refers to Charousek as "The Austrian Morphy" INCORRECT
After Charousek's International debut Chigorin began referring to him as "The New Morphy." Steinitz as we know was called "The Austrian Morphy." The reviewer complains that "crack" is not a word in English, and makes fun of the translators for being stupid. In fact, the word "crack", meaning "expert," was in wide use in the late 19th century. It appears regularly in newspaper articles to denote an "expert" chess player- As in "Pillsbury and other cracks appeared at the...." etc. Note to the reviewer:
There is perhaps nothing more stupid= nothing- than laughing at how stupid someone else is when YOU are the person who's got the facts wrong. However as I said, largely accurate review otherwise. Don't you love chess history? |
